Types of Doors Before diving into the systems of door security, it is vital to comprehend the numerous types of doors that can be utilized in residential and commercial settings. Below is a table categorizing common door types:
Door Type Description Security Features Strong Wood Heavy and durable, strong wood doors supply a natural visual. Typically has a deadbolt, however can be vulnerable if not reinforced. Steel Steel doors offer high resilience and resistance versus required entry. Typically geared up with multi-point locking systems. Fiberglass Lightweight and resistant to weather, fiberglass doors can mimic wood textures. They can be reinforced with steel frames for added security. Sliding Common in outdoor patio applications, these doors move horizontally rather than swing open. Need to have locks and secondary stopping systems. French Double doors that can be extremely welcoming however can provide security risks if not protected effectively. Needs strong locks and possibly extra security bars. Security Screen Designed to provide air flow while keeping out trespassers, security screens are made from resilient materials. Features sturdy locks and reinforced mesh. Locking Mechanisms The kind of locking system used on doors considerably impacts their security. Here's an introduction of common locking mechanisms:
Lock Type Description Security Level Deadbolt A robust locking system that extends a solid metal bolt into the door frame. High Knob Lock A typical lock found on residential doors, but reasonably simple to bypass. Low to Moderate Lever Handle Lock Common on both residential and commercial doors, often utilized in combination with a deadbolt. Moderate Smart Lock Electronic locks that can be managed via mobile phone applications or keypads. Varies by model Mortise Lock A lock that fits into a pocket (mortise) cut into the edge of the door, offering strength. Below are numerous tips for enhancing door security at your home or business:
Install a Deadbolt: Ensure that every exterior door is equipped with a high-quality deadbolt lock for additional security. Strengthen Door Frames: Upgrade door frames with steel supports to avoid break-in. Use Security Bars or Grills: For sliding doors, consider setting up security bars to prevent them from being lifted off their tracks. Change the Strike Plate: Use longer screws to secure strike plates to the door frame, enhancing resistance to forced entry. Maintain Your Locks: Regularly examine and preserve locks to ensure they function effectively. Lube them regularly. Think About Smart Options: Evaluate smart locks and security systems that offer additional access control and monitoring. Install a Peephole: A wide-angle peephole enables you to see who is at the door without opening it. Outside Lighting: Keep entry points well-lit to deter potential trespassers. Use Alarm Systems: Pair door locks with alarm systems for an included layer of security. FAQ About Door Security Q1: What is the most secure kind of door?A1: Steel doors are
generally thought about the most secure alternative due to their sturdiness and resistance to required entry. Q2: Are wise locks safe?A2: Yes, when correctly
set up and frequently upgraded, smart
locks can use secure and hassle-free gain access to. Nevertheless, they are vulnerable to hacking, so it's essential to pick respectable brands and follow finest practices for cybersecurity. Q3: How often should I change my door locks?A3: It is recommended to alter your locks when moving
into a brand-new home, after losing a secret, or if you suspect unauthorized access. Q4: Can I install a deadbolt myself?A4: Yes, numerous deadbolts come with installation sets and guidelines, making it possible for homeowners to
install them with standard tools
. Q5: What is the very best way to secure sliding doors?A5: Use a security bar, eliminate the deal with to make it unusable, and install a strong lock
to enhance the security of sliding doors.
